How much does it cost to rent an apartment in East Hartford?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| East Hartford Studio Apartments | $1,539 | $885 | $3,002 |
| East Hartford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,874 | $995 | $2,760 |
| East Hartford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,263 | $1,072 | $3,975 |
| East Hartford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,170 | $1,300 | $4,210 |
| East Hartford 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,041 | $845 | $4,223 |
